syncytium A large cell-like structure formed by the joining together of two or more cells. The plural is syncytia.

synovial sarcoma A malignant tumor that develops in the synovial membrane of the joints.

synergistic Describes the interaction of two or more drugs such that their combined effect is greater than the sum of the individual effects seen when each drug is given alone.

synchronized culture a culture of bacterial or animal cells in which all cells are in the same phase of cell division.

synchrony The carefully coordinated interaction between the parent and the child or adolescent in which, often unknowingly, they are attuned to each other's behavior.
